How to fill out the Compensation Leave online
Filling out the Compensation Leave form is an important process that allows staff to formally request time off for extra hours worked. This guide will provide you with clear, step-by-step instructions to successfully complete the online form.
Follow the steps to complete the Compensation Leave form accurately.
- Click ‘Get Form’ button to access the Compensation Leave form and open it in your preferred online editor.
- Enter your staff name in the designated field. Be sure to provide your full name as it appears in university records.
- Input your section or department name in the ‘Section’ field. This helps to identify where you are located within the organization.
- Fill in the date that the duty was performed in the format of DD/MM/YY. This is essential for tracking purposes.
- Specify the time range for the duty performed. Indicate the start and end time of the hours worked in the respective ‘From’ and ‘To’ fields.
- Indicate the total number of hours worked during this period in the appropriate field, ensuring it aligns with the time range you provided.
- Provide justifications for the compensation leave requested in the ‘Duty to be performed’ section. This is critical for approval by your section head.
- Complete the remarks section if additional notes are needed regarding your compensation leave request.
- Sign the form in the designated area, followed by entering the current date to validate your application.
- Ensure the section head reviews and endorses the application by signing it and dating it upon approval.
- Once all the required fields are completed, you can save your changes, download, print, or share the form as needed.
